The authors of this collection are students at Frank W. Ballou High School in Washington, DC. They worked in collaboration with Shout Mouse Press and the ShootBack Project to tell their stories through their own words and photographs.

"One hour after I displayed the book "How To Grow Up Like Me" in our middle school library, it was seized upon by an 8th grade boy who is a reluctant reader... and [who] had only checked out one other book while in middle school. He made an instant connection with the honest and powerful stories written inside. This student ran to show the book to his reading teacher. He is now captivated and can't wait to come to class to read the inspiring collection with our students. This is real. This is life-changing." -- Librarian, Hardy Middle School, Washington, DC "I was so inspired by the powerful stories published by your students from Ballou! The narrative is so similar to my students here in Memphis and so many kids from urban school districts around the country. There is a need for a writing project like this here. Our students just don't have as many opportunities as they should to express how they feel and to be listened to." -- Teach For America Instructor, Memphis, TN
